What Common Problems Do These Tools Fix?
Garage doors face wear and tear daily, which means a variety of tools are needed for different repairs. Professionals typically deal with:
Broken garage door spring replacement using winding bars and safety vises
Garage door opener installation with drills, sockets, and alignment tools
Cable replacements using pliers and precision clamps
Roller and track repairs with levels and impact drivers
Overhead door adjustments with torque wrenches and lubricants
Emergency garage door repair near me situations that require cutting, bracing, or electrical tools
Alongside these, technicians rely on safety tools like gloves, goggles, and clamps to prevent accidents. These are everyday essentials in garage door maintenance and tune-up.

What Is the Cost Breakdown of Tool-Based Services?
Service Type | Average Cost (USD) | Notes on Tools Used |
Broken Garage Door Spring Replacement | $150 – $350 | Winding bars, safety vises, torque tools |
Garage Door Opener Installation | $300 – $650 | Drills, socket kits, alignment tools |
Cable or Roller Repair | $90 – $200 | Pliers, clamps, impact drivers |
Track Adjustment or Panel Repair | $200 – $800 | Levels, drills, precision brackets |
Garage Door Maintenance & Tune-Up | $100 – $200 | Lubricants, cleaning brushes, inspection kits |
Emergency Garage Door Repair (24 hr) | $150 – $400 | Full kit including bracing and safety tools |

How Does Safety Depend on Tools?
Safety is non-negotiable in garage door repairs. Without the correct winding bars or clamps, a spring replacement can be extremely dangerous. That’s why technicians rely on specialized safety gear like goggles, insulated gloves, and secure braces. Using high-grade tools prevents accidents, protects the door system, and ensures smoother operation. Homeowners should never attempt DIY spring adjustments with basic tools—it’s a job best left to specialists.
